‘The Brazil We Knew Is Gone’ – Sunday Oliseh Eviscerates Selecao After Norway Upset
Sunday Oliseh, former Super Eagles coach, delivered a harsh verdict on Brazil’s national team after their stunning quarterfinal exit at the 2026 FIFA World Cup. He said the Selecao have lost the fear factor and flair that once defined them. Brazil fell 2-1 to Norway at the New York New Jersey Stadium thanks to two Erling Haaland strikes. Bruno Guimaraes missed an early penalty, and Gabriel Martinelli and Vinicius Junior were repeatedly denied by an inspired performance from Norwegian keeper Ørjan Nyland. Norway seized control in the second half. Haaland headed in the opener in the 79th minute and sealed the historic win with a thunderbolt outside the box at the 90th minute. The result sends shockwaves through the tournament as Norway reach their first World Cup semifinal. Oliseh then took to social media to criticise Brazil’s tactical indiscipline and lacklustre attitude. “The Brazil we used to know is completely gone,” he wrote, praising Norway’s discipline and clinical finishing.
